Bible Verses About Never Leaving

Deuteronomy 31:6

“Be strong and courageous. Do not be afraid or terrified because of them, for the Lord your God goes with you; he will never leave you nor forsake you.” – Deuteronomy 31:6

This verse speaks of God’s constant support. By encouraging strength and courage, it reminds us that our fears are small compared to God’s power. We can take comfort knowing that He walks beside us through every challenge. His promise of never leaving is a profound reassurance, granting us the confidence to face anything life throws our way.

Hebrews 13:5

“Keep your lives free from the love of money and be content with what you have, because God has said, ‘Never will I leave you; never will I forsake you.'” – Hebrews 13:5

This verse emphasizes contentment and trust in God’s provision. The assurance that He will never forsake us allows us to shift our focus away from material desires. Knowing that God’s presence is always with us brings strength and a sense of security that nothing else can replace, allowing us to live in peace.

Isaiah 41:10

“So do not fear, for I am with you; do not be dismayed, for I am your God. I will strengthen you and help you; I will uphold you with my righteous right hand.” – Isaiah 41:10

This passage provides a powerful reminder of God’s commitment to help us in our struggles. His promise to strengthen us assures us that we are never alone in our battles. We can lean on Him during difficult times, trusting that He will uplift us with His power and presence.

Psalms 139:7-10

“Where can I go from your Spirit? Where can I flee from your presence? If I go up to the heavens, you are there; if I make my bed in the depths, you are there.” – Psalms 139:7-10

This passage beautifully illustrates the omnipresence of God. There is no place we can go to escape His loving presence. His unyielding companionship provides us comfort, reminding us that no matter where we find ourselves, we are surrounded by His love and care, even in our toughest moments.

Matthew 28:20

“And surely I am with you always, to the very end of the age.” – Matthew 28:20

In this verse, Jesus promises His followers that He will always be with them. It is a comforting reminder that even as times change, His commitment to us never wavers. Knowing that we have His support gives us courage and strength, allowing us to move forward with confidence every day.

John 14:18

“I will not leave you as orphans; I will come to you.” – John 14:18

This verse reassures us that we are never abandoned by God. His promise to return to us reflects His deep care and love. Even in moments of loneliness, we are reminded that God is always present, and we are part of His family, belonging and cherished.

Psalms 23:4

“Even though I walk through the darkest valley, I will fear no evil, for you are with me; your rod and your staff, they comfort me.” – Psalms 23:4

This famous passage assures us of God’s presence even during our darkest times. His protection brings comfort amid fear. We can trust that God is right beside us, guiding and comforting us through the challenging experiences of life, reinforcing that we are never truly alone.

Romans 8:38-39

“For I am convinced that neither death nor life, neither angels nor demons, neither the present nor the future, nor any powers, neither height nor depth, nor anything else in all creation, will be able to separate us from the love of God.” – Romans 8:38-39

This powerful declaration reveals the strength of God’s love. Regardless of our circumstances, we are assured that nothing can separate us from His presence and care. This adds a sense of security to our lives, reminding us that God is always with us and loves us unconditionally through it all.

Isaiah 43:2

“When you pass through the waters, I will be with you; and when you pass through the rivers, they will not sweep over you. When you walk through the fire, you will not be burned; the flames will not set you ablaze.” – Isaiah 43:2

This verse highlights God’s promise to be with us during life’s trials. Whether we face overwhelming challenges or threatening situations, God assures us that we will emerge safe. His presence brings peace to our hearts, knowing He walks alongside us through every storm and fire.

1 Peter 5:7

“Cast all your anxiety on him because he cares for you.” – 1 Peter 5:7

God invites us to share our worries and concerns with Him. This act of casting our anxieties upon Him signifies our trust in His care. It reassures us that we are not alone in our struggles; He is always present and attentive to our needs, available to support us through life’s difficulties.

Joshua 1:9

“Have I not commanded you? Be strong and courageous. Do not be afraid; do not be discouraged, for the Lord your God will be with you wherever you go.” – Joshua 1:9

This encouragement from God reassures us that He equips us to face challenges. Courage and strength come from knowing He is always present. Regardless of where we go or what we encounter, we do not have to face it alone, as He walks with us every step of the way.

Exodus 33:14

“The Lord replied, ‘My Presence will go with you, and I will give you rest.'” – Exodus 33:14

In this verse, God promises that His presence brings rest to our weary souls. His companionship provides comfort, reminding us that we can find peace even in difficult times. We can rely on Him for rest when life is heavy, knowing we’re never alone in our burdens.

2 Timothy 4:17

“But the Lord stood at my side and gave me strength, so that through me the message might be fully proclaimed and all the Gentiles might hear it.” – 2 Timothy 4:17

This passage emphasizes the importance of God’s presence as a source of strength. In moments of struggle or uncertainty, He empowers us to fulfill our purpose. Knowing that God stands beside us equips us to face challenges with confidence, reminding us that we are never deserted in our mission.

Psalms 46:1

“God is our refuge and strength, an ever-present help in trouble.” – Psalms 46:1

This verse reassures us of God’s constant availability as a source of strength. During challenging times, we can run to Him for refuge, knowing He is always there to help. His unwavering presence empowers us to navigate through difficulties, reminding us that we are never truly alone.

Psalms 121:8

“The Lord will watch over your coming and going both now and forevermore.” – Psalms 121:8

This verse paints a picture of God attentively watching over us in all aspects of our lives. His constant vigilance assures us that we are always in His care. Whether we feel lost or uncertain, we can trust that He guides our steps and never leaves our side.

John 16:32

“A time is coming and in fact has come when you will be scattered, each to your own home. You will leave me all alone. Yet I am not alone, for my Father is with me.” – John 16:32

In this verse, Jesus reassures us that even in moments of abandonment, He is never truly alone because His Father is with Him. This promise reminds us that even in our loneliness, God’s presence is sufficient. We can lean on Him during lonely times, knowing He is always near.

Micah 7:8

“Do not gloat over me, my enemy! Though I have fallen, I will rise. Though I sit in darkness, the Lord will be my light.” – Micah 7:8

This verse highlights the faith we can have in God’s guiding light. When we stumble or feel trapped in darkness, we can trust God to help us rise again. His light pierces through the shadows of loneliness and despair, reassuring us that we are never abandoned in our struggles.

James 4:8

“Come near to God and he will come near to you.” – James 4:8

This verse emphasizes the mutuality of our relationship with God. By drawing near to Him, we open ourselves to experience His presence. He is always ready to embrace us, showing that even in our moments of doubt or loneliness, He is waiting patiently for us to seek Him.

1 Corinthians 10:13

“No temptation has overtaken you except what is common to mankind. And God is faithful; he will not let you be tempted beyond what you can bear.” – 1 Corinthians 10:13

Here, we find comfort in knowing God’s faithfulness during tough challenges. He won’t allow us to face tests that we cannot withstand. This assurance reminds us of His constant presence, empowering us to stand firm, knowing we are never left to struggle alone.

Philippians 4:19

“And my God will meet all your needs according to the riches of his glory in Christ Jesus.” – Philippians 4:19

This passage reassures us that God is aware of our needs. He promises to provide for us out of His abundance. This gives us confidence that, as we trust Him, we are never left wanting, emphasizing His sustaining presence in our lives.

Proverbs 18:10

“The name of the Lord is a fortified tower; the righteous run to it and are safe.” – Proverbs 18:10

This verse depicts God as a source of safety and refuge. We can find solace in His presence amidst storms and struggles. He stands as our fortress, ensuring that we can seek refuge and safety whenever we feel overwhelmed, reinforcing that we are never abandoned.

Luke 12:32

“Do not be afraid, little flock, for your Father has been pleased to give you the kingdom.” – Luke 12:32

This verse reassures us of God’s loving care and willingness to bless us. The invitation to not be afraid eliminates our loneliness and replaces it with confidence. Knowing He desires to give us His kingdom reminds us of our value, encouraging us that we are never truly alone.

Romans 15:13

“May the God of hope fill you with all joy and peace as you trust in him, so that you may overflow with hope by the power of the Holy Spirit.” – Romans 15:13

This passage speaks of God as the source of hope and peace. As we place our trust in Him, we can expect Him to fill our hearts with joy. Knowing that the Holy Spirit empowers us reassures us that we are surrounded by His presence, ensuring we are never abandoned.

Jeremiah 29:11

“For I know the plans I have for you,” declares the Lord, “plans to prosper you and not to harm you, plans to give you hope and a future.” – Jeremiah 29:11

This well-loved verse emphasizes that God has a purpose for our lives. By trusting Him and His plans, we can experience a future full of hope. It reminds us that God’s presence is guiding us toward a better tomorrow, keeping us assured that we are never alone in our journey.
